Suggest Treatment For Higher Levels Of Createnine

Hi, my mother in law had brain aneurysm and had surgery 3 months back. At the time of surgery doctors found that her createnine levels are high. She is seeing a nephrologist also for this but still she has high levels of createnine 5.7. She has eating disorder and not taking enough food. Does she need a dialysis or kidney transplantaion?

Hematologist 's  Response
Hi, dear.
I have gone through your question. I can understand your concern. You have some kidney disease. You should go for complete kidney function test including GFR and ultrasound abdomen. If your gfr is severely depleted then dialysis is needed. She should drink plenty of water. Lasix can be given to lower creatinine accordingly.
so consult your doctor and take treatment accordingly.
